Postgraduate Certificate in Applied Business Computing holds significant importance in today's market, particularly in the UK. According to a report by the Higher Education Statistics Agency (HESA), there were over 34,000 students enrolled in postgraduate computing courses in the UK in 2020-21, with a growth rate of 10% from the previous year.

Year Number of Students
2019-20 30,600
2020-21 34,100

Course content


• Database Management Systems •
• Data Mining and Business Intelligence •
• E-commerce and Digital Marketing •
• Information Systems Security •
• Business Process Re-engineering •
• Human-Computer Interaction •
• Cloud Computing and Virtualization •
• Business Analytics and Decision Support •
• IT Project Management and Control


Assessments

The assessment process primarily relies on the submission of assignments, and it does not involve any written examinations or direct observations.
